Dubai, UAE – Pickleball, the world’s fastest growing sport, has announced the launch of the new Pickleball World Rankings (PWR), the PWR World Series, and the PWR World Tour. The announcement was made during a significant event held in Dubai, UAE, highlighting the sport’s global surge in popularity. The GCC region was named as the host for the first PWR World Series in March 2025, an event backed by Pickleball League Asia Private Limited in partnership with The Times Group.

The PWR aims to unify regional bodies under a single structure to enhance governance and ensure the sport’s longevity. The announcement featured key figures from international Pickleball bodies and some of the world’s top players, including Megan Fudge DeHeart, the women’s world number one on the APP Tour.

Pranav Kohli, CEO and Founder of PWR, emphasized the sport’s humble beginnings in the backyards of America in the sixties and its evolution into a global phenomenon. He expressed his honor in being part of the creation of the Pickleball World Rankings, PWR World Series, and PWR World Tour, and his excitement for taking the sport to the next level both on and off the court.

Kohli announced that the PWR World Tour will offer USD $15 million in prize money, with USD $1.5 million allocated for the GCC stop in the PWR World Series. This prize pool is the highest ever offered in the sport. He hopes that current stars and future champions from the United States and around the world will rise through the rankings and reach their full potential, engaging millions of global followers.

He also highlighted the strategic choice of the GCC region for the announcement, citing its ambition, visionary leadership, and positive societal changes that align with the sport’s growth.

Vineet Jain, Managing Director of The Times Group, expressed pride in being an anchor investor in PWR, describing it as a groundbreaking initiative that unifies the global Pickleball community. Jain believes that Pickleball will soon overtake Tennis in terms of participation and views PWR as a platform that will empower players worldwide to compete and showcase their talents on an international stage.

Pickleball has already gained worldwide recognition, enjoyed by celebrities such as Bill Gates, Elon Musk, and Taylor Swift. It is the fastest-growing sport in the USA and is poised to become the fastest-growing sport globally.
